  • <strong>Achille Perilli</strong> (Rome, January 28, 1927 – Orvieto, October 16, 2021) represents one of the most authoritative and revolutionary figures in the Italian and international art scene of the post-war period. His tireless research, aimed at overcoming figuration and exploring the power of the "sign," has left an indelible mark on the evolution of <strong>geometric abstraction</strong>. Raised in a fervent cultural climate, Perilli attended classical high school and enrolled in the Faculty of Letters, where he attended lectures by Lionello Venturi, a key figure in his critical development. During these formative years, he grew convinced of the need to break away from Italian academic tradition, which was still tied to the legacies of the past.
